Transaction 13d729d93197a4b11f97de1f592464647694be430958317f5ef089d57bc707e7

block
9bd48c51b6db3b5215ba88a4dccb19df3bfca4cd2c96c4b05ee6a54e49f9bf21

214 Inputs

2001 Outputs